Habit #4: Living a Sedentary Lifestyle
Why Inactivity Hurts the Liver
Physical inactivity reduces the body’s ability to burn fat and regulate insulin.
Even people who are not overweight can develop fatty liver if they are sedentary.
Effects of Sitting Too Much
- Reduced fat oxidation
- Increased insulin resistance
- Accumulation of liver fat
- Slower metabolic rate
Movement signals the liver to release stored fat and improve insulin sensitivity.
Habit #5: Overeating and Constant Snacking
Why Quantity Matters
Even healthy foods become harmful when eaten in excess. Constant eating keeps insulin levels elevated, preventing fat breakdown.
The Liver’s Role
When excess calories are consumed, the liver converts them into fat for storage—often in its own cells.
Late-night eating worsens this effect because insulin sensitivity is lower at night.
